Kepler Volleys reach 3rd place in 1LVV preparation tournament

Kepler Volleys reach 3rd place in 1LVV preparation tournament

Saturday, September 21, 2024 Tournament Gameday

Today, Kepler Volleys took part in the 1LVV Preparation Tournament, finishing with an impressive 3rd place. The tournament was a fantastic opportunity to test our skills and asses our progress as we gear up for the season ahead.

Group Stage

In our group, we faced familiar opponents in Powervolleys Freistadt and Steelvolleys Herren 2, both of whom we had previously played in friendly test matches. Alongside them, we met the team from UNIONvolleys Bisamberg-Hollabrunn. In the group stage we claimed victories agains both Steelvolleys 2 and Bisamberg. These wins secured us 2nd place in our group, narrowly behind Freistadt.

Semi-Final

Advancing to the semi-finals, we faced off against Steelvolleys Herren 1, a strong team competing in the 1st Landesliga. While we knew this would be a tough challenge, we gave our best effort and played well by our standards. In both sets, we managed to keep up with them early on, staying close at 8:9 and 7:8. However, Steelvolleys 1 then found their rhythm and went on decisive scoring runs that left us struggling to catch up. While in the end we didn't come close to winning we could show our skills and learn valuable lessons to improve our game.

The Fight for 3rd Place

In a twist of fate, our final match saw us facing Freistadt once again, this time with 3rd place on the line. Both teams were eager to finish strong, and the match was close from the start. After splitting the first two sets, everything came down to a deciding 3rd set. We stayed focused and played well as a team, managing to pull ahead in the end and win the golden set. It was a hard-fought victory, and we were happy to finish the tournament in 3rd place.
